Couple of things... Squeezing/expanding the tube body to proper dimensions, smooth/polish the inside of the tube, smooth up the follower removing any burrs (you want follower and spring to move like melted butter inside without any catching), taking a diamond coated file and smooth the feed lips to remove any burrs, bending the feed lips to proper dimensions for the caliber while ensuring the front of the feed lips are opened up a little more than the rear of the feed lips.

And I'm sure there are more steps involved, but those are the ones that I used. Purchase a Dawson mag tuning kit and you get a video that explains most of it.

Does it even make sense to use factory unturned mags in a custom built open gun?

An open guns slide -Normally-moves a lots faster than a limited slide. My open gun would run fine with clean mags and good springs. = I would change them every year.

my limited gun with the very same mags has gone 3 years with the same springs and very little mag maintenance. = two of them just now bit me on a stages.
